Transaction ee5379566d53e08a65e8ce6b5e39b943995a20a8ef50ae2fb0ca8913a5c40e9d
1 Input
2 Outputs
- ee5379566d53e08a65e8ce6b5e39b943995a20a8ef50ae2fb0ca8913a5c40e9d:0
- ee5379566d53e08a65e8ce6b5e39b943995a20a8ef50ae2fb0ca8913a5c40e9d:1
value 1178451
address 1EDgk5yL1eauK29fcbHsjcuCSt4MzUTpgH
value 1335220
address 1P2LkGeHhbUB3nfc8osukJdHYFkk9FWsT6